意思是,PCA不接受稀疏矩阵?
有办法将稀疏矩阵传入PCA么?——试着转为数组形式(toarray)
如不行,那应该如何操作?——使用SVD(scikit-learn中有)
参考代码:
from sklearn.feature_extraction.text import TfidfVectorizer
from sklearn.cluster import KMeans
from sklearn.decomposition import TruncatedSVD
from sklearn.preprocessing import Normalizer
from sklearn.pipeline